编程题
### 问题描述 小郭在和小周玩一种新型的棋牌,小周分别给小郭 $a$ 个数值为 $x$,$b$ 个数值为 $y$,$c$ 个数值为 $z$ 和一个数值为 $d$ 的棋牌,问小郭能否恰好使用两种棋牌使其数值总和等于 $d$。(任选两种的棋牌的数量可以不用完。即若选了数值为 $x$ 和 $y$ 的棋牌,其牌数可以不用完,但不能多用。) ### 输入格式 第一行输入六个数,分别表示 $a,x,b,y,c,z$。 第二行输入一个数,表示 $d$。 ### 输出格式 仅输出一行,可以的话在第一行输出“YES”,否则,输出“NO”。 ### 样例输入 ```text 4 3 4 2 3 5 11 ``` ### 样例输出 ```text YES ``` ### 样例输入 ```text 1 3 1 4 3 5 11 ``` ### 样例输出 ```text NO ``` ### 样例说明 第一个样例中三个 3 加上一个 2 等于 11。 第二个样例中不管拿出哪两个数无法使数的总和为 11。 ### 评测数据规模 对于 $100\%$ 的评测数据,$1\leq a,b,c,x,y,z \leq 100$ ,$2\leq d \leq 10^5$。 注意 $x,y,z$ 两两各不同。
查看答案
赣ICP备20007335号-2